  • Abstract
    An electronic switch prototype has been developed for control of a high temperature superconductor (HTS) R-C-L series resonant device. The device built mainly consists of an electronic power switch with potential use of a high Q HTS inductor. In practice electrical resistance in the circuit, which mainly comes from the inductor, limits the voltages that can be achieved. Consequently an inductor with low resistance is required to achieve high voltage generation and a higher current. This paper will describe the prototype device, and the high voltage generation method.
